Transaction 796203fda97c6a0d64ddb2a668f06c4e8d55ee2d41ef0e515d12194e9a1d1fa9
1 Input
1 Output
-
796203fda97c6a0d64ddb2a668f06c4e8d55ee2d41ef0e515d12194e9a1d1fa9:0
- value
- 2566000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ad9f1d1cee57e4c73c752017f133f06d15ba734 OP_EQUAL
- address
- 3EMCG5CPeSL2sUQRwEPiPHuxGJ4a9UT99e